Episode 320: Personal Productivity Metrics🔗 Read the full article here: https://smartkeys.org/personal-productivity-metrics/In this episode of the SmartKeys podcast, we break down a sobering reality: in early 2025, U.S. worker productivity dropped by nearly a full percentage point, despite our teams having access to more task managers, chat apps, and AI assistants than ever before. We explore why the traditional corporate metric of tracking raw input versus raw output completely fails in the modern office, and how to stop confusing digital presenteeism with actual business value. Based on the comprehensive guide by Felix Römer, we lay out a practical playbook for quantifying your daily progress. We unpack how to introduce a balanced measurement stack that protects your mental bandwidth, prevents burnout, and ensures your team is doing meaningful, high-impact work. In this episode, you will learn:The Planned-to-Done Reality Check: How tracking the ratio of tasks completed versus tasks initially assigned forces you to confront optimism bias and align your daily ambitions with your actual capacity. Shielding Focus Hours: The metric behind protecting 60-to-120 minute windows for deep, uninterrupted work, and how to track your virtual meeting load to see exactly where your cognitive energy is being drained. Quality Over Raw Volume: Why measuring task completion counts means nothing if half the work has to be redone. We cover First-Contact Resolution (FCR) for internal handoffs, tracking defect escape signals to log rework, and gathering lightweight customer satisfaction (CSAT) cues. Ditching the Velocity Trap: Why using team-level planning metrics (like velocity) to grade an individual employee’s performance is an operational hazard that inevitably breeds sandbagging and gaming behavior. The Short Weekly Loop: How to build a lightweight, agile routine—composed of a Monday plan, a midweek check, and a 15-minute Friday retro—to turn personal data into intentional weekly experiments that compound over time.
